M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
describes
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
changes in
digital education technology have enabled
people
all over the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a lot of
subjects that
technology-enhanced learning organizations
are dealing with
more than ever because online learning technology is
developing so swiftly.
How can teachers
make sure that
the quality of teaching provided by these
MOOC courses is
adequate?
How can learners
assure that
teachers are properly credentialed
to teach classes online?
What business models are being used by
organizations like
Udacity to conduct these MOOC courses?
What innovative assessment strategies and teaching practices are in use today?
How can we
manage issues like
poor
learner mot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
As online learning becomes more
available there is a
desire
to be aware of how
MOOC courses are being conducted.
Scholars
and lots of other
participants
would like
to better comprehend
the outcomes of these
important new open education
undertakings.
Lecturers want
to comprehend how
these MOOC classes
can be made better.
In response to this
need for
knowledge
MOOCs and Open Education
offers a critical analysis of
MOOCs and other open educational resource issues.
This intriguing new book
also researches the
controversies associated with
MOOC courses and open education resources (OER).
